Output 70ae5bd4db6e8b03926a9481dfedcf456608023499bfcd8d528e1e8446d1f789:2

value
20408778
script pubkey
OP_0 OP_PUSHBYTES_32 f217bec026fdebb9777152f86eb5ceb01c09ec98cf1082bdbca5139a8353c8ca
address
bc1q7gtmaspxlh4mjam32tuxadwwkqwqnmyceugg90du55fe4q6ner9q96egx9
transaction
70ae5bd4db6e8b03926a9481dfedcf456608023499bfcd8d528e1e8446d1f789
spent
true